Abhijit Bhattacharyya is a scholar working on Materials Chemistry, Biomedical Engineering and Mechanical Engineering. According to data from OpenAlex, Abhijit Bhattacharyya has authored 47 papers receiving a total of 611 ind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Materials Chemistry, 13 papers in Biomedical Engineering and 13 papers in Mechanical Engineering. Recurrent topics in Abhijit Bhattacharyya’s work include Shape Memory Alloy Transformations (23 papers), Advanced machining processes and optimization (8 papers) and Chemical Mechanical Polishing in Microelectronics Manufacturing (6 papers). Abhijit Bhattacharyya is often cited by papers focused on Shape Memory Alloy Transformations (23 papers), Advanced machining processes and optimization (8 papers) and Chemical Mechanical Polishing in Microelectronics Manufacturing (6 papers). Abhijit Bhattacharyya collaborates with scholars based in United States, India and Canada. Abhijit Bhattacharyya's co-authors include Dimitris C. Lagoudas, M.G. Faulkner, Brian P. Mann, Jun Yang, Jacob H. Masliyah, Vikram K. Kinra, Muhammad Imran, Daniel Y. Kwok, Ganesh K. Kannarpady and John K. Schueller and has published in prestigious journals such as Acta Materialia, Journal of Colloid and Interface Science and Computer Methods in Applied Mechanics and Engineering.
